Meta and X Approve AI Ads Referencing Nazi War Crimes Ahead of German Elections, Research Finds
- Meta and X approved AI-generated ads promoting hate speech and violence against minorities ahead of Germany's federal elections on February 23, according to research by EkM.
- Meta approved five extremist ads within 12 hours, while X approved all ten ads immediately, as stated by EkM.
- These ads violate European tech laws and platforms' policies on hate speech, raising questions about their compliance with the Digital Services Act, according to Peter Hense.
- EkM submitted findings to the European Commission, noting that both platforms continue to allow illegal hate speech and have made no efforts to address moderation risks, as reported by an EkM spokesperson.
